This video tutorial covers solving secant equations without a calculator by using the unit circle and reference triangles. It explains the process of solving secant Theta = 2/√3 and secant Theta = √2, detailing the reciprocal relationship between secant and cosine, and identifying the quadrants where these functions are positive or negative. The tutorial also demonstrates how to use reference triangles to find solutions, emphasizing the importance of understanding both methods.
